Steve Nash played for 6 seasons with the Mavs, two of which he was an all-star. Nash reflected on his years with the Huffington Post and certainly didn’t hold back.
“I think yeah we would have won maybe more than one championship if we would have stayed together,” he told HuffPost Live’s Marc Lamont Hill on Tuesday. “You know, Mark’s put incredible resources into that team. Energy, passion, ideas.”
“I think I played my best basketball from that point on,” he added. “Obviously Dirk was unbelievable and won a championship there, and I think it could have been something great, but I don’t spend much time thinking about it. But the arrogant cocky part of me is like, ‘Yeah, would would have won.'”
